首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

穿戴操作系统权限屏幕从不在第一次运行应用程序时显示-黑屏

,是指在穿戴设备上运行应用程序时,操作系统不会在第一次运行应用程序时显示权限屏幕,而是直接进入黑屏状态。

这种行为的目的是为了提升用户体验,避免在每次运行应用程序时都显示权限屏幕,从而减少用户的操作步骤和等待时间。

然而,这种行为也存在一定的安全风险。因为应用程序可能需要获取一些敏感权限,如访问用户的位置信息、读取联系人等。如果操作系统在第一次运行应用程序时不显示权限屏幕,用户将无法知晓应用程序所需权限的具体内容,可能会导致用户对应用程序的信任度降低。

为了解决这个问题,开发者可以在应用程序中添加必要的权限说明,明确告知用户应用程序所需的权限,并在用户第一次运行应用程序时显示权限屏幕,让用户可以自主选择是否授予相应的权限。

腾讯云相关产品中,与穿戴操作系统权限屏幕相关的产品可能包括:

  1. 腾讯移动分析(https://cloud.tencent.com/product/mta):提供移动应用数据分析服务,开发者可以通过该产品了解用户在应用程序中的行为和使用情况,从而优化应用程序的用户体验。
  2. 腾讯移动推送(https://cloud.tencent.com/product/tpns):提供移动应用消息推送服务,开发者可以通过该产品向用户发送通知消息,包括权限相关的提示和说明。

请注意,以上仅为示例,具体的产品选择应根据实际需求进行评估和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

开机黑屏或空白屏幕

如果你仍看到黑屏或空白屏幕,请尝试 操作 4中的步骤以执行干净启动。 操作 4:执行干净启动 使用正常启动方式启动 Windows ,一些应用程序和服务会自动启动,然后在后台运行。...如果你遇到黑屏或空白屏幕问题,并且 Windows 在更新之前正常运行,那么你可以回退显示适配卡驱动程序,以撤消更新 Window 10 所做的更改。...如果你仍看到黑屏或空白屏幕,请尝试操作 8中的步骤以执行干净启动。 操作 8:执行干净启动 使用正常启动方式启动 Windows ,一些应用程序和服务会自动启动,然后在后台运行。...一定要知道执行干净启动并不会解决你的黑屏或空白屏幕问题。 如果设备处于干净启动环境中未发生问题,则可以按秩序打开或关闭启动应用程序或服务,然后重启设备,来确定启动应用程序或服务是否会导致该问题。...每次用光盘恢复系统之后,第一次开机就会黑屏,等待长达十多分钟之后,更新了显卡驱动,问题迎刃而解,再也没出现过!!!

7.3K21

Win系统使用WSL子系统Linux启动vGPU增强图形性能加速OpenGL

已修复的问题 游戏应用程序有时会卡在 Radeon RX 6800 系列图形产品上以低于预期的图形时钟运行。...与 Radeon RX 6800 系列显卡产品一起运行时,HP Reverb G2 VR 耳机可能无法同步或出现黑屏。...某些显示器(例如 Scepter C 系列或 Samsung™ Odyssey G9 系列)在 Radeon RX 6000 系列图形产品上可能会出现间歇性黑屏。...某些游戏在设置为无边框全屏可能会出现卡顿,并且连接了扩展显示器并在 RDNA 图形产品上运行 Netflix™ windows store 应用程序。...使用 MSI Afterburner 可能会观察到屏幕闪烁。 在某些游戏和系统配置上启用增强同步可能会导致出现黑屏。任何可能在启用增强同步遇到问题的用户都应将其禁用作为临时解决方法。

2.5K30
  • Android性能之冷启动优化详析

    2.APP启动方式 冷启动(Cold start) 场景:冷启动是指APP在手机启动后第一次运行,或者APP进程被kill掉后在再次启动。...其中TotalTime代表当前Activity启动时间 4.冷启动流程 冷启动指的是应用程序从进程在系统不存在,到系统创建应用运行进程空间的过程。...冷启动通常会发生在一下两种情况: 1)设备启动以来首次启动应用程序 2)系统杀死应用程序之后再次启动应用程序 在冷启动的最开始,系统需要负责做三件事: 1)加载以及启动app 2)app启动之后立刻显示一个空白的预览窗口...6)执行第一次绘制 一旦app进程完完成了第一次绘制工作,系统进程就会用main activity替换前面显示的预览窗口,这个时候,用户就可以正式开始与app进行交互了。...很显然,如果你的application或activity启动的过程太慢,导致系统的BackgroundWindow没有及时被替换,就会出现启动白屏或黑屏的情况(取决于你的主题是Dark还是Light)

    89410

    你的 APP 为何启动那么慢?

    App启动方式 ---- 冷启动(Cold start) 冷启动是指APP在手机启动后第一次运行,或者APP进程被kill掉后在再次启动。...进程启动后系统还有一个工作就是:进程启动后立即显示应用程序的空白启动窗口。 一旦系统创建应用程序进程,应用程序进程就会负责下一阶段。...这些阶段是: 1.创建应用程序对象 2.启动主线程 3.创建主要Activity 4.绘制视图(View) 5.布局屏幕 6.执行初始化绘制 而一旦App进程完成了第一次绘制,系统进程就会用Main Activity...image.png 这里很明显有两个优化点: 1.Application OnCrate()优化 当APP启动,空白的启动窗口将保留在屏幕上,直到系统首次完成绘制应用程序。...避免主线程做耗时操作 用户体验优化 消除启动的白屏/黑屏 ? 冷启动白屏.gif 为什么启动时会出现短暂黑屏或白屏的现象?

    1.9K20

    游戏优化系列三:Unity游戏的黑屏问题解决方法

    1、生命周期分析 (1)黑屏情况 (2)解决方法 (3)正常显示 2、涉及方法解析 (1)onWindowFocusChanged (boolean hasFocus) (2)Android生命周期...,发现屏幕黑屏;或者打开了其他接受输入焦点的对话框或弹出窗口,点击返回键发生屏幕黑屏,需要触摸屏幕(获得焦点)才能正常显示。...除非它显示了其他接受输入焦点的对话框或弹出窗口,在这种情况下,当其他窗口有焦点,活动本身就没有焦点。...(还不能响应输入事件) onPause ():活动仍在屏幕上可见,但用户不再与其交互进行调用,eg:弹框等页面覆盖了当前活动。...-- OnLevelWasLoaded:场景全部加载完成后 -- Start:仅当启用脚本实例后,才会在第一次帧更新之前调用 Start。

    5.9K01

    【测评】OrangePi AIPro环境配置与基础应用

    2.环境配置 开发板已经预装好了Ubuntu22.04系统,C++编译器和Python等基础环境也是装好的,第一次开机我们连接上网络后查看ip,然后就可以通过ssh远程登陆了,不用再依赖屏幕。...当然也可以安装nomachine,方便桌面操作,效果如图: 常用的查看系统信息的命令: uname -a #显示内核版本、操作系统名称、主机名、处理器的架构等基本系统信息lsb_release -a #...显示发行版名称、版本号、发行版ID等详细信息 lshw #列出所有检测到的硬件设备及其详细信息 lspci #列出所有PCI设备及其详细信息 df -h #显示磁盘分区的使用情况 free -m #显示内存使用情况...top #查看系统监控信息 另外,可对开发板禁用睡眠模式,防止睡眠后黑屏: sudo systemctl status sleep.target sudo systemctl stop sleep.target...它提供了一系列工具、库和约定,用于构建机器人应用程序。 ROS 2采用分布式消息传递机制,可以在不同的计算机上进行通信,并支持多种编程语言,包括C++、Python、Java等。

    20910

    【远程控制软件】上海道宁助您通过TeamViewer远程访问和即时远程支持,最大化远程工作团队的生产力

    04、用户和设备配置管理 利用特殊权限和许可证管理安全性。设置策略并创建群组,以分配特殊访问权限。 远程访问 居家办公。 出差在外。...01、主要特性 可永久访问无人值守的设备 可进行局域网唤醒和远程重启 远程访问显示黑屏,保护您的隐私 安全灵活的文件共享 支持 Windows 和 MacOS 远程打印...01、主要特性 可在iPhone和 iPad 上共享屏幕 可安全传输文件且可在 iOS 系统的文件应用程序中管理传输内容 可在移动设备间建立连接 可在 TeamViewer 桌面应用程序中查看系统诊断...04、管理和监控 使用移动仪表板检查 CPU 负载、磁盘空间或操作系统版本,或远程配置移动设备。...05、部署与集成 TeamViewer QuickSupport 应用和 Host 应用可让您为公司访问和支持有人值守或无人值守的移动设备,包括运行 Android 的商业级设备,如数字标牌、交互信息亭或销售终端系统

    1.5K20

    Windows10黑屏怎么办 Win10黑屏如何解决

    可能原因: 1、win10操作系统设置的原因,如屏幕保护,电源管理。 2、此外win10显示卡驱动程序不兼容等也会引起 电脑黑屏 现象,出现这样情况,只需重新安装驱动程序以及调试系统即可解决。...3、当然也有可能病毒引起黑屏,如开机显示信息后,进桌面突然黑屏,那么可能系统遭到病毒破坏,这种情况可以用重做系统或还原解决。...4、不得不提一下一些很常见却又可能被忽略的情况,如 显示器 电源 插头 松了,不通电,又或者VGA接口接触不良,又或者显示器 开关 有些小故障的,没按到。如果全部确认无误后,我们才确定是硬件故障。...5、散热问题:计算机开机后,正常进入系统,运行一段时间后(或正常使用一小段时间),突然黑屏,这种情况很大可能是散热引起的情况,正常温度为30-50度,一般情况下,任何部件超过50度都会引起主板保护,所以电脑就...4、进入到安全模式后,如果在黑屏之前安装过什么就可在安全模式中将软件卸载删除,如果不确定的话,可进行干净启动,干净启动的操作步骤如下: 1) 按“Win+R”打开“运行”窗口, 输入msconfig命令后按回车

    3.3K20

    Windows 中的 UAC 用户账户控制

    而不黑屏,不会切换到新的桌面环境,原有程序依然可以获得此 UAC 弹窗的一些信息,这很不安全。 但是!...如果你是管理员账户,那么运行的程序都将以管理员权限运行。 从 Windows 8 开始到现在的 Windows 10,虽然依然是上面四个设置,但拖到最底的“从不通知”,UAC 依然是开启的状态。...,可以对 Windows 操作系统做任何事。...当程序需要以管理员权限运行(对应 High 级别的令牌),可以自己在 Manifest 里面声明,也可以自己使用 runas 谓词重启自己。而这个时候是会弹出 UAC 提示的,用户知情。...关于如何通过 Manifest 设置管理员权限运行,可以参考我的另一篇博客: 应用程序清单 Manifest 中各种 UAC 权限级别的含义和效果 权限提升 在 Windows 系统中,不同权限的进程是隔离的

    2.1K10

    HarmonyOS的功能及场景应用

    具体来说,鸿蒙系统是一款面向全场景(移动办公、运动健康、社交通信、媒体娱乐等)的分布式操作系统,能够支持手机、平板、智能穿戴、智慧屏、车机等多种终端设备,通过同一套系统能力、适配多种终端形态。...HarmonyOS的设计理念是跨设备平台,允许开发者创建一次,运行多次的应用程序,从而提供更无缝的用户体验。...鸿蒙OS凭借多终端开发IDE,多语言统一编译,分布式架构Kit提供屏幕布局控件以及交互的自动适配,支持控件拖拽,面向预览的可视化编程,从而使开发者可以基于同一工程高效构建多端自动运行App,实现真正的一次开发...四、鸿蒙OS的优点 分布式架构:鸿蒙系统采用了分布式架构,将应用程序的不同模块分别部署在不同的设备上,实现了跨设备的运行和数据交换,充分发挥不同设备的优势,提高设备的协同效率,同时也为应用程序的开发提供了更大的灵活性...此外,鸿蒙系统还提供了完善的应用权限管理功能,限制应用程序对用户数据的访问权限,防止数据泄露和滥用。 支持多种设备类型:鸿蒙系统支持多种设备类型,包括智能家居设备、穿戴设备、车载设备等。

    49810

    ❤️Android 性能优化之启动优化❤️

    冷启动 冷启动是指应用从头开始:冷启动发生在设备启动后第一次启动应用程序 (Zygote>fork>app) ,或系统关闭应用程序后。 在冷启动开始,系统有三个任务。...创建 Application 当应用程序启动,空白启动页面保留在屏幕上,直到系统首次完成应用程序的绘制。...第一次绘制你的应用程序。...不要创建全局静态对象,而是转向单例模式,应用程序只在第一次需要初始化对象。 此外,考虑使用依赖注入框架(如Hilt) 繁琐的Activity初始化 活动创建通常需要大量高开销工作。...尤其是大型应用, 经常出现几秒钟的黑屏或白屏,黑屏或白屏取决于主界面 Activity 的主题风格。

    89160

    Android可穿戴设备世界之旅

    安卓健体 从技术上讲,它是专为可穿戴智能手表和计算机设计的 Android 操作系统版本。...请注意操作系统和 JDK 之间的版本(32/64 位)匹配。 Wear App 的设计原则 由于手表的屏幕比移动设备更小,因此该平台的设计原则与传统的 Android 应用程序有很大不同。...构建您的首款 Wear 应用程序 首先,我们将集中精力制作一个“Hello Wear”应用程序,该应用程序将演示制作基本磨损应用程序并将应用程序运行到磨损模拟器中的步骤。...图 1:更改string.xml中的文本值 现在运行项目。您将找到如下输出。滑动屏幕退出应用程序。它完成了我们的“Hello Android Wear”应用程序。...rect_activity_main.xmlround_activity_main.xml 当我们制作另一个针对方形屏幕的模拟器并运行我们之前所做的相同项目,输出看起来相似,但文本值不是,因为我们没有更改文件中方形屏幕

    11310

    VMware Workstation 15基本介绍

    VMware Workstation 允许操作系统应用程序在一台虚拟机内部运行。虚拟机是独立运行主机操作系统的离散环境。...在 VMware Workstation 中,你可以在一个窗口中加载一台虚拟机,它可以运行自己的操作系统应用程序。...你可以在运行于桌面上的多台虚拟机之间切换,通过一个网络共享虚拟机,挂起和恢复虚拟机以及退出虚拟机,这一切不会影响你的主机操作和任何操作系统或者其它正在运行应用程序。...多启动系统在一个时刻只能运行一个系统,在系统切换需要重新启动机器。 VMware 是真正“同时”运行多个操作系统在主系统的平台上,就像标准 Windows 应用程序那样切换。...11、虚拟NVMe存储的性能改进 12、已解决的问题 直接使用物理磁盘的虚拟机可能显示黑屏当虚拟机直接使用物理磁盘,在启动虚拟机后,虚拟机可能会显示黑屏。 此问题已得到解决。

    3.6K50

    启动优化

    冷启动指的是该应用程序在此之前没有被创建,发生在应用程序首次启动或者自上次被终止后的再次启动。简单的说就是app进程还没有,需要创建app的进程并启动app。...比如开机后,点击屏幕的app图标启动应用。 冷启动的过程主要分为两步: 1)系统任务。加载并启动应用程序显示应用程序的空白启动窗口;创建APP进程 2)APP进程任务。...启动主线程;创建Activity;加载布局;屏幕布局;绘制屏幕 其实这不就是APP的启动流程嘛?所以冷启动是会完整走完一个启动流程的,从系统到进程。 温启动。...优化方案 1)消除启动的白屏/黑屏 App启动的时候会有一个白屏/黑屏时间,我们可以通过设置windowBackground属性来给启动的Activity提供一个drawable,这样就给用户一个快递启动的假象了...总结 最后再和大家回顾下今天说到的启动优化方案: 消除启动的白屏/黑屏。windowBackground。 第三方库懒加载/异步加载。线程池,启动器。 预创建Activity。对象预创建。

    93330

    Cloak ; Dagger攻击:一种可针对所有版本Android的攻击技术(含演示视频)

    Android设备特定功能所必须的权限。...BIND_ACCESSIBILITY_SERVICE ("a11y") 第一个权限名叫“draw on top”,这个权限将允许App在设备屏幕显示额外的叠加窗口来覆盖其他的App界面。...第二个权限为“a11y”,这个权限旨在帮助包括盲人和视力障碍用户在内的残疾人用户更好地通过语音命令来输入信息或通过屏幕阅读功能来了解屏幕内容。 攻击者能做什么?...研究人员在接受采访解释了他们如何在Google Play应用商店中实现Cloak& Dagger攻击: “我们提交了一款需要申请上述这两种权限的App,App中包含一个下载并执行任意代码的函数(没有经过代码混淆...(整个过程中屏幕保持黑屏状态); 简而言之,Cloak & Dagger攻击将允许攻击者悄悄拿到Android设备的完整控制权,并监控你在自己手机上的一举一动。

    1.1K50

    2020年移动发展趋势

    构建可折叠应用程序 随着三星推出可折叠的 OLED 显示屏,操作系统已经准备好利用此技术来改善智能手机的体验。...由于“可折叠手机”将成为 2020 年的下一个流行语,因此您需要制定一种可在可折叠设备上无缝运行的移动应用开发策略。展开设备以提供更大的屏幕可能会对用户产生积极影响,并影响移动产品的设计。...机器学习和人工智能 大家都知道著名的移动应用程序 FaceApp,该应用程序一夜成名,因为它出色地利用了人工智能(AI)。它将滤镜添加到用户的照片中,以显示他们的年轻和年老的样子。...并且,当深度学习与 ML 联手,它可以通过提供有价值的数据和实时分析为移动应用程序开发项目创造奇迹。...通过独立于 iPhone 运行应用程序,Apple 已将 Apple Watch 的定位升级为用户可用于其数字需求的独立设备。

    56830

    【移动应用趋势】2022 年值得关注的 15 大移动应用开发趋势

    因此,在规划移动应用程序开发策略,您也应该牢记可折叠设备。确保您的应用程序在可折叠设备上无缝运行——这是 2022 年具有挑战性的移动应用程序开发趋势。...它为 Apple Watch 用户带来了新功能、全新的表盘、增加了钱包访问权限以及重新设计的界面。...甚至谷歌也宣布了一个统一的可穿戴设备平台,将其可穿戴操作系统与三星的 Tizen 软件平台相结合——将应用程序启动时间提高了 30%。...以下是我们今年可以在我们周围看到的一些类型的 P2P 移动应用程序: 具有内置支付功能的社交媒体平台。 带有内置支付系统的移动操作系统。...涉及银行作为支付方的 P2P 应用程序。 加密货币钱包。 如果您有一个 P2P 移动应用程序的想法,现在就是将其变为现实的最佳时机。 12. 区块链 我们第一次听说区块链是在加密货币繁荣时期。

    1.8K10

    APP测试类型—App自动化测试与框架实战(2)

    软件的稳定性测试可以借鉴以下公式:   MTBF(时间/次)=N个选样产品总运行时间之和/N个产品发现的指标BUG之和   也就是说,当测试MTBF,可以选择多个产品并行测试,将其并行运行时间和期间发现的...App还要考虑各种操作系统上的PAD产品,因为PAD并不属于通信设备,在硬件构造上和手机不同,屏幕尺寸也比手机大很多。..." 智能可穿戴设备。常见的智能可穿戴设备有智能手表、智能手环。...比如,当分辨率较高屏幕上一行能显示80个汉字;当分辨率较低屏幕上一行只能看到40个汉字。   对于这项兼容性,不仅App要测试,传统软件也要测试。...兼容性就是测试软件对分辨率的自适应性,即会不会因为分辨率改变界面显示情况。

    69120
    领券